Unfortunately, I don't think there's as much going on this weekend as there was last weekend.

Chapel Hill is having their Earth Day events this weekend (I think everyone else held them last weekend).
Earth Action Day | Chapel Hill Parks & Recreation

You could go on a guided tour of the NC Botanical Garden in Chapel Hill (I've been wanting to do this myself ).
North Carolina Botanical Garden - A Conservation Garden

Are there any civil war history buffs in the group? They might enjoy seeing downtown Hillsborough or the Bennet House in Durham.
Bennett Place

And of course, there are the museums in the area like the Nasher at Duke. There are a few plays showing right now, but I suspect you won't want to dedicate 2 nights of your guests' visit watching "Angels in America".
